Car Cards (Interior)

Description: Interior subway car cards are positioned in frames above passenger seats. Some markets offer backlit panels. Rail cards are on bulkhead walls of most commuter coaches, near doors. Sizes available vary by market and include 11" x 28", 11" x 42", 11" x 46", 11" x 56", 11" x 70", 22" x 21" and 33" x 21." Used to reach subway and suburban rail riders.

Availability: Most major markets with rapid transit, subway or commuter rail systems.
Subway: New York; Boston; Philadelphia; Chicago; Washington, DC; Atlanta; San Francisco; Miami; Cleveland; Baltimore; Buffalo
Commuter Rail: New York; New Jersey; Philadelphia; Chicago; Washington, DC; Atlanta; Buffalo

Advantages:
• Longer viewing time allows for more copy than standard posters
• Regular riders mean high frequency
• Suburban portion is effective for reaching upscale audiences

Terms: Interior car cards are purchased in GRP programs reflecting the percent exposure to total ridership. For rates, information on specific market availability and production specifications, please click here and submit your request. Source: OAAA
